    Watch Dogs 2 has a rating of Mature (17+)
    For the following items: Blood, Intense Violence, Nudity, Sexual Themes, Strong Language, Use of Drugs

    Although WD2 is rated mature, I found it quite tame.

    It is nowhere as crude as the GTA franchise. I saw nudity only in the hippie garden area, but even that is almost clinical, with no sensual overtones.

    Even the violence is a bit detached and low on gore. Furthermore, you can be a purist and beat the game without firing a lethal weapon all game (using stunners only).

    I would say they figured out a good balance to satisfy all audiences, fully knowing that a rated M game is still going to be played by younger people.
